Average First-Line Supervisors of Mechanics, Installers, and Repairers Salary in Allentown-Bethlehem-Easton, PA-NJ

First-Line Supervisors of Mechanics, Installers, and Repairers in the Allentown-Bethlehem-Easton, PA-NJ area earn an average annual salary of $82,390. This figure is remarkably close to the national average of $82,890, indicating a stable and competitive compensation landscape. Local economic factors and the specific demands of the region's industrial and service sectors likely contribute to this alignment.

First-Line Supervisors of Mechanics, Installers, and Repairers Salary Distribution in Allentown-Bethlehem-Easton, PA-NJ

Career progression for First-Line Supervisors of Mechanics, Installers, and Repairers typically involves a significant salary increase with experience. Entry-level positions might start closer to the lower percentiles, while seasoned professionals with extensive leadership experience and technical expertise can command salaries well into the upper percentiles. The widening gap between entry-level and senior roles highlights the value placed on accumulated knowledge and proven management capabilities.

Experience LevelMarket PercentileAnnual WageHourly Rate
ApprenticeLearning trade under supervision. Classroom + OJT.10% (Entry)$49,440$23.8
JourneymanLicensed/Certified. Works independently on standard tasks.25% (Junior)$61,793$29.7
Senior TechnicianHandles complex installations & troubleshooting.50% (Median)$79,150$38.1
Foreman / MasterSupervises crews, handles permits & code compliance.75% (Senior)$102,988$49.5
SuperintendentSite management, business owner, or master tradesman.90% (Expert)$118,600$57

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 1,350 employees in the Allentown-Bethlehem-Easton, PA-NJ area with a job density of 3.637 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
